Certain NETGEAR devices are affected by a buffer overflow. This affects D6200 before 1.1.00.24, D7000 before 1.0.1.52, JNR1010v2 before 1.1.0.44, JR6150 before 1.0.1.12, JWNR2010v5 before 1.1.0.44, PR2000 before 1.0.0.20, R6020 before 1.0.0.26, R6050 before 1.0.1.12, R6080 before 1.0.0.26, R6120 before 1.0.0.36, R6220 before 1.1.0.60, R6700v2 before 1.2.0.12, R6800 before 1.2.0.12, R6900v2 before 1.2.0.12, WNDR3700v5 before 1.1.0.50, WNR1000v4 before 1.1.0.44, WNR2020 before 1.1.0.44, and WNR2050 before 1.1.0.44.

A buffer overflow vulnerability in multiple NETGEAR router models allows remote attackers to execute arbitrary code or cause denial of service via crafted network requests. The vulnerability affects the listed device models running firmware versions prior to the specified thresholds. The CVSS 7.8 indicates network-exploitable, low-complexity attack requiring no authentication.

MitigationUpgrade affected NETGEAR devices to the patched firmware versions specified in the advisory. If firmware updates are unavailable, restrict network access to trusted users and disable remote management interfaces exposed to untrusted networks.

Work through these to decide whether this CVE applies to you.

  1. Identify your NETGEAR router model
    Locate the model number on the device label or log into the router web interface (typically 192.168.1.1) and check the status or administration page for the model name
    Affected if The model is one of: D6200, D7000, Jnr1010, Jr6150, Jwnr2010, PR2000, R6020, or R6050
  2. Check the installed firmware version
    In the router web interface, navigate to the Administration or Firmware Upgrade section and locate the current firmware version displayed
    Affected if The displayed firmware version is below the threshold for your specific model (D6200: 1.1.00.24, D7000: 1.0.1.52, Jnr1010: 1.1.0.44, Jr6150: 1.0.1.12, Jwnr2010: 1.1.0.44, PR2000: 1.0.0.20, R6020: 1.0.0.26, R6050: 1.0.1.12)
  3. Confirm network exposure of the router management interface
    Verify whether the router admin web interface is accessible from the WAN/internet or if remote management is enabled in the router settings
    Affected if The router management interface is reachable from untrusted networks, increasing the likelihood of remote exploitation

You are affected if you own one of the listed NETGEAR models and your current firmware version is below the specified threshold for that model.
